Perfecting the Crispy Coating: Tips for Air Frying Country Fried Steak

Country fried steak is a classic Southern dish that is loved by many for its crispy coating and juicy meat. Traditionally, this dish is made by frying the steak in oil, but with the rise of air fryers, it is now possible to achieve the same delicious results with less oil.

In this section, we will share some tips and tricks to help you perfect the crispy coating when air frying country fried steak.

1. Choose the Right Cut of Meat

When it comes to country fried steak, the choice of meat is crucial. Look for a cut of meat that is tender and flavorful, such as cube steak or top round steak. These cuts are ideal for frying as they have enough marbling to keep the meat moist and tender.

2. Tenderize the Meat

Tenderizing the meat before coating and frying is essential to ensure a juicy and tender steak. You can use a meat tenderizer or a fork to gently pound the meat, breaking down the muscle fibers and making it more tender.

3. Season the Meat

Before coating the steak, it is important to season it well. Use a combination of salt, pepper, garlic powder, and paprika to enhance the flavor of the meat. You can also add other spices or herbs according to your preference.

4. Create the Coating

The crispy coating is what sets country fried steak apart. To create the perfect coating for air frying, you will need three shallow bowls. In the first bowl, mix flour, salt, and pepper. In the second bowl, beat eggs with a little milk.

In the third bowl, combine breadcrumbs or crushed crackers with your favorite seasonings.

5. Properly Coat the Steak

To ensure an even and crispy coating, it is important to properly coat the steak. Start by dredging the steak in the flour mixture, shaking off any excess. Then dip it into the egg mixture, allowing any excess to drip off. Finally, coat the steak with the breadcrumb mixture, pressing it gently to adhere.

6. Preheat the Air Fryer

Before placing the coated steak in the air fryer, make sure to preheat it. This will help to create a crispy crust and prevent the coating from sticking to the basket. Preheat the air fryer to the recommended temperature for frying.

7. Cook in Batches

Depending on the size of your air fryer, you may need to cook the country fried steak in batches. Overcrowding the air fryer can result in uneven cooking and a less crispy coating. Allow enough space between each piece of steak for optimal air circulation.

8. Flip and Spray with Oil

To achieve an evenly crispy coating, flip the steak halfway through the cooking process. This will ensure that both sides are golden brown and crispy. Additionally, lightly spray the steak with cooking oil or olive oil spray to enhance the browning and crispiness.

9. Check for Doneness

To ensure that the country fried steak is cooked to perfection, use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ature. The steak should reach an internal temperature of 145°F for medium-rare or 160°F for medium. Avoid overcooking the steak as it can result in a dry and tough texture.

10. Let it Rest

Once the country fried steak is cooked, remove it from the air fryer and let it rest for a few minutes before serving. This will allow the juices to redistribute and the coating to set, resulting in a more flavorful and tender steak.

Cooking Time and Temperature for Country Fried Steak in an Air Fryer

If you love the taste of crispy and flavorful country fried steak, but want to make it healthier by using an air fryer, you’re in luck! Cooking country fried steak in an air fryer can give you the same delicious results with less oil and fewer calories.

In this section, we’ll discuss the recommended cooking time and temperature for preparing country fried steak in an air fryer.

Ingredients:

  • 4 country fried steak patties
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 eggs, beaten
  • 1 cup breadcrumbs

Instructions:

1. Preheat your air fryer to 400°F (200°C). This will ensure that the steak cooks evenly and becomes crispy.

2. In a shallow dish, mix together the flour, pa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and black pepper. This seasoned flour will add flavor to the country fried steak.

3. Dip each country fried steak patty into the beaten eggs, allowing any excess to drip off.

4. Coat the steak patties in the seasoned flour mixture, pressing it onto both sides to ensure even coating.

5. Dip the coated steak patties back into the beaten eggs, and then coat them with breadcrumbs. The breadcrumbs will add an extra crunch to the fried steak.

6. Place the breaded steak patties in a single layer in the air fryer basket. Make sure to leave some space between each patty for even air circulation.

7. Cook the country fried steak in the air fryer at 400°F (200°C) for 12-15 minutes, flipping them halfway through. The exact cooking time may vary depending on the thickness of the steak patties and the air fryer model you are using.

8. After the cooking time is up, remove the steak patties from the air fryer and let them rest for a few minutes before serving. This allows the juices to redistribute, resulting in a moist and tender steak.

Serving Suggestions:

Country fried steak is often served with creamy mashed potatoes and gravy. You can also pair it with a side of steamed vegetables or a fresh salad for a balanced meal.

For a classic country-style meal, top the fried steak with homemade white or brown gravy. Simply melt some butter in a saucepan, whisk in flour to create a roux, and then gradually add milk or broth until the gravy thickens. Season it with salt, pepper, and any additional herbs or spices you prefer.

Healthier Alternative: Air Fried Country Fried Steak Recipe

In this section, we will be exploring a healthier alternative to the classic country fried steak recipe. Instead of deep frying, we will be using an air fryer to create a delicious and crispy steak that is lower in calories and fat.

Follow along as we break down the steps to make this healthier version of a beloved comfort food.

Ingredients:

  • 4 cube steaks
  • 1 cup buttermilk
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ional for extra heat)
  • Non-stick cooking spray

Instructions:

  1. Start by marinating the cube steaks in buttermilk for at least 30 minutes. This will help tenderize the meat and add flavor.
  2. In a shallow dish, combine the flour, pa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, black pepper, and cayenne pepper (if desired).
  3. Remove the steaks from the buttermilk and dredge them in the flour mixture, pressing gently to ensure the coating sticks.
  4. Preheat your air fryer to 400°F (200°C) for a few minutes.
  5. Lightly coat the air fryer basket with non-stick cooking spray.
  6. Place the breaded steaks in a single layer in the air fryer basket, making sure they are not overlapping.
  7. Cook the steaks in the air fryer for 10 minutes, then flip them over and cook for an additional 5-7 minutes until they are golden brown and crispy.
  8. Remove the steaks from the air fryer and let them rest for a few minutes before serving.

Achieving Juicy and Tender Country Fried Steak in an Air Fryer

If you are a fan of country fried steak, but are looking for a healthier cooking option, then using an air fryer may be the perfect solution for you. The air fryer allows you to achieve that crispy outer coating while keeping the inside juicy and tender.

In this section, we will discuss the steps to achieve juicy and tender country fried steak using an air fryer.

Ingredients:

  • 1 pound of cube steak
  • 1 cup of all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on of salt
  • 1 teaspoon of black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on of paprika
  • 1 teaspoon of gar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on of on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on of dried thyme
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/4 cup of buttermilk
  • Cooking spray

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your air fryer to 400°F (200°C) for about 5 minutes.
  2. In a shallow dish, whisk together the flour, salt, black pepper, pa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, and dried thyme.
  3. In a separate bowl, beat the eggs and buttermilk together until well combined.
  4. Dip each piece of cube steak into the flour mixture, coating both sides evenly. Shake off any excess flour.
  5. Next, dip the coated steak into the egg mixture, making sure to fully coat both sides.
  6. Return the steak to the flour mixture and coat it again, pressing the flour mixture gently into the meat to adhere.
  7. Lightly spray the air fryer basket with cooking spray to prevent sticking.
  8. Place the coated steak into the air fryer basket in a single layer, making sure they are not touching.
  9. Lightly spray the top of the steaks with cooking spray to help them brown and become crispy.
  10. Cook the steak in the air fryer for 10-12 minutes, flipping halfway through the cooking time.
  11. Check the internal temperature of the steak with a meat thermometer. It should read 145°F (63°C) for medium-rare or 160°F (71°C) for medium.
  12. Once cooked to your desired doneness, remove the steak from the air fryer and let it rest for a few minutes before serving.

Serving Suggestions and Variations for Air Fried Country Fried Steak

Country fried steak is a classic Southern dish that is loved for its flavorful crispy coating and tender meat. While traditionally it is made by pan-frying, using an air fryer can provide a healthier alternative without compromising on taste.

Once you have mastered the art of air frying country fried steak, you can experiment with various serving suggestions and variations to enhance the overall dining experience.

Serving Suggestions:

  • Traditional Style: Serve your air fried country fried steak with creamy mashed potatoes and homemade white country gravy. The combination of the crispy steak, smooth potatoes, and rich gravy creates a comforting and satisfying meal.
  • Biscuits and Gravy: For a classic Southern twist, pair your steak with fresh-baked biscuits smothered in the same delicious country gravy. This combination is perfect for a hearty breakfast or brunch.
  • Steak Sandwich: Slice the air fried country fried steak and serve it on a toasted bun with lettuce, tomato, and your favorite condiments. This option allows for a convenient and tasty handheld meal.
  • Salad Topping: Cut the air fried steak into strips and use it as a protein topping for a vibrant salad. Combine it with mixed greens, cherry tomatoes, cucumber, and a tangy vinaigrette for a light and refreshing meal.
  • Steak and Eggs: Serve the air fried country fried steak alongside sunny-side-up eggs for a classic breakfast combination. Add a side of hash browns or home fries for a complete morning meal.

Variations:

While the traditional country fried steak recipe is already delicious, you can explore different variations to add your own personal touch. Here are a few ideas:

  • Spicy Kick: Add some heat to your air fried country fried steak by incorporating cayenne pepper or hot sauce into the seasoning. The spicy flavor will complement the crispy coating and elevate the overall taste.
  • Cheesy Goodness: Before air frying, top the steak with shredded cheese, such as cheddar or mozzarella, and let it melt and become golden and bubbly in the air fryer. This cheesy variation adds an extra layer of indulgence.
  • Herb Infusion: Mix herbs like thyme, rosemary, and oregano into the coating mixture to infuse the steak with aromatic flavors. This variation adds a burst of freshness to the dish.
  • Gluten-Free Option: Substitute traditional flour with gluten-free alternatives like almond flour or cornmeal for a gluten-free version of country fried steak. This variation caters to those with dietary restrictions.
  • Vegetarian Twist: Use thick slices of eggplant or Portobello mushrooms instead of steak to create a vegetarian-friendly version of country fried “steak.” The air frying process will still yield a crispy exterior while keeping the vegetables tender and flavorful.
